M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
studies
topics
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
changes in
elearning technology have provided the means for
students
in all parts of the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
These MOOC courses are
almost always free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are many
subjects that
blended learning organizations
are struggling with
now that technology-enhanced learning is
developing so swiftly.
How can organizations
certify that
the quality of these
massively open online courses is
adequate?
How can organizations
ensure that
educators are properly credentialed
and qualified for online teaching?
What different business models are being used by
organizations like
University of Wisconsin – Madison to conduct these MOOC courses?
What innovative assessment strategies and teaching practices are in use today?
How can we
deal with the issues of
poor
motivation and high
attrition?
